A Markdown parser in under 100 JS LoC, taken from http://pzxc.com/simple-javascript-markdown-parsing-function

if (typeof markdown === 'undefined') var markdown = { | |
parse: function (s) { | |
var r = s, ii, pre1 = [], pre2 = []; | |
// detect newline format | |
var newline = r.indexOf('\r\n') != -1 ? '\r\n' : r.indexOf('\n') != -1 ? '\n' : '' | |
// store {{{ unformatted blocks }}} and <pre> pre-formatted blocks </pre> | |
r = r.replace(/{{{([\s\S]*?)}}}/g, function (x) { pre1.push(x.substring(3, x.length - 3)); return '{{{}}}'; }); | |
r = r.replace(new RegExp('<pre>([\\s\\S]*?)</pre>', 'gi'), function (x) { pre2.push(x.substring(5, x.length - 6)); return '<pre></pre>'; }); | |
// h1 - h4 and hr | |
r = r.replace(/^==== (.*)=*/gm, '<h4>$1</h4>'); | |
r = r.replace(/^=== (.*)=*/gm, '<h3>$1</h3>'); | |
r = r.replace(/^== (.*)=*/gm, '<h2>$1</h2>'); | |
r = r.replace(/^= (.*)=*/gm, '<h1>$1</h1>'); | |
r = r.replace(/^[-*][-*][-*]+/gm, '<hr>'); | |
// bold, italics, and code formatting | |
r = r.replace(/\*\*(.*?)\*\*/g, '<strong>$1</strong>'); | |
r = r.replace(new RegExp('//(((?!https?://).)*?)//', 'g'), '<em>$1</em>'); | |
r = r.replace(/``(.*?)``/g, '<code>$1</code>'); | |
// unordered lists | |
r = r.replace(/^\*\*\*\* (.*)/gm, '<ul><ul><ul><ul><li>$1</li></ul></ul></ul></ul>'); | |
r = r.replace(/^\*\*\* (.*)/gm, '<ul><ul><ul><li>$1</li></ul></ul></ul>'); | |
r = r.replace(/^\*\* (.*)/gm, '<ul><ul><li>$1</li></ul></ul>'); | |
r = r.replace(/^\* (.*)/gm, '<ul><li>$1</li></ul>'); | |
for (ii = 0; ii < 3; ii++) r = r.replace(new RegExp('</ul>' + newline + '<ul>', 'g'), newline); | |
// ordered lists | |
r = r.replace(/^#### (.*)/gm, '<ol><ol><ol><ol><li>$1</li></ol></ol></ol></ol>'); | |
r = r.replace(/^### (.*)/gm, '<ol><ol><ol><li>$1</li></ol></ol></ol>'); | |
r = r.replace(/^## (.*)/gm, '<ol><ol><li>$1</li></ol></ol>'); | |
r = r.replace(/^# (.*)/gm, '<ol><li>$1</li></ol>'); | |
for (ii = 0; ii < 3; ii++) r = r.replace(new RegExp('</ol>' + newline + '<ol>', 'g'), newline); | |
// links | |
r = r.replace(/\[\[(http:[^\]|]*?)\]\]/g, '<a target="_blank" href="$1">$1</a>'); | |
r = r.replace(/\[\[(http:[^|]*?)\|(.*?)\]\]/g, '<a target="_blank" href="$1">$2</a>'); | |
r = r.replace(/\[\[([^\]|]*?)\]\]/g, '<a href="$1">$1</a>'); | |
r = r.replace(/\[\[([^|]*?)\|(.*?)\]\]/g, '<a href="$1">$2</a>'); | |
// images | |
r = r.replace(/{{([^\]|]*?)}}/g, '<img src="$1">'); | |
r = r.replace(/{{([^|]*?)\|(.*?)}}/g, '<img src="$1" alt="$2">'); | |
// video | |
r = r.replace(/<<(.*?)>>/g, '<embed class="video" src="$1" allowfullscreen="true" allowscriptaccess="never" type="application/x-shockwave/flash"></embed>'); | |
// hard linebreak if there are 2 or more spaces at the end of a line | |
r = r.replace(new RegExp(' + ' + newline, 'g'), '<br>' + newline); | |
// split on double-newlines, then add paragraph tags when the first tag isn't a block level element | |
if (newline != '') for (var p = r.split(newline + newline), i = 0; i < p.length; i++) { | |
var blockLevel = false; | |
if (p[i].length >= 1 && p[i].charAt(0) == '<') { | |
// check if the first tag is a block-level element | |
var firstSpace = p[i].indexOf(' '), firstCloseTag = p[i].indexOf('>'); | |
var endIndex = firstSpace > -1 && firstCloseTag > -1 ? Math.min(firstSpace, firstCloseTag) : firstSpace > -1 ? firstSpace : firstCloseTag; | |
var tag = p[i].substring(1, endIndex).toLowerCase(); | |
for (var j = 0; j < blockLevelElements.length; j++) if (blockLevelElements[j] == tag) blockLevel = true; | |
} else if (p[i].length >= 1 && p[i].charAt(0) == '|') { | |
// format the paragraph as a table | |
blockLevel = true; | |
p[i] = p[i].replace(/ \|= /g, '</th><th>').replace(/\|= /g, '<tr><th>').replace(/ \|=/g, '</th></tr>'); | |
p[i] = p[i].replace(/ \| /g, '</td><td>').replace(/\| /g, '<tr><td>').replace(/ \|/g, '</td></tr>'); | |
p[i] = '<table>' + p[i] + '</table>'; | |
} else if (p[i].length >= 2 && p[i].charAt(0) == '>' && p[i].charAt(1) == ' ') { | |
// format the paragraph as a blockquote | |
blockLevel = true; | |
p[i] = '<blockquote>' + p[i].replace(/^> /gm, '') + '</blockquote>'; | |
} | |
if (!blockLevel) p[i] = '<p>' + p[i] + '</p>'; | |
} | |
// reassemble the paragraphs | |
if (newline != '') r = p.join(newline + newline); | |
// restore the preformatted and unformatted blocks | |
r = r.replace(new RegExp('<pre></pre>', 'g'), function (match) { return '<pre>' + pre2.shift() + '</pre>'; }); | |
r = r.replace(/{{{}}}/g, function (match) { return pre1.shift(); }); | |
return r; | |
} | |
}; |

var mdown = function (s) { | |
var r = s; | |
// detect newline format | |
var newline = r.indexOf('\r\n') != -1 ? '\r\n' : r.indexOf('\n') != -1 ? '\n' : '' | |
// h1 - h2 and hr | |
r = r.replace(/^== (.*)=*/gm, '<h2>$1</h2>'); | |
r = r.replace(/^= (.*)=*/gm, '<h1>$1</h1>'); | |
r = r.replace(/^[-*][-*][-*]+/gm, '<hr>'); | |
// bold, italics | |
r = r.replace(/\*\*(.*?)\*\*/g, '<strong>$1</strong>'); | |
r = r.replace(new RegExp('//(((?!https?://).)*?)//', 'g'), '<em>$1</em>'); | |
// unordered lists | |
r = r.replace(/^\* (.*)/gm, '<ul><li>$1</li></ul>'); | |
r = r.replace(new RegExp('</ul>' + newline + '<ul>', 'g'), newline); | |
// links & images | |
r = r.replace(/\[\[([^|]*?)\|(.*?)\]\]/g, '<a href="$1">$2</a>'); | |
r = r.replace(/{{([^\]|]*?)}}/g, '<img src="$1">'); | |
// split on double-newlines, then add paragraph tags when the first tag isn't a block level element | |
if(newline != '') { | |
for(var p = r.split(newline + newline), i = 0; i < p.length; i++) { | |
p[i] = '<p>' + p[i] + '</p>'; | |
} | |
r = p.join(newline + newline); // reassemble the paragraphs | |
} | |
return r; | |
} |
